Materials
Blended synthetic fibers.
Weight: 25oz/sq yd (2.78oz/sq ft)
Thickness: 0.11”
Density: 18.9lbs/ft^3
R-Value: @ 0.11” = 0.46 hr-ft^2-degF/Btu (4.19/inch)
Flammability: Meets or exceeds Federal Flammability Standard: CPSC FF 1-70 (Pill Test)
Sound
Field Impact Insulation Class (FIIC)
• 3/8” Engineered wood flooring over Insulayment, over 8” concrete sub-floor with no ceiling assembly (double glued). FIIC = 60.
• Ceramic tile over Insulayment (latex modified thin set and grout), over 8” concrete sub-floor with no ceiling assembly. FIIC = 60.
Impact Insulation Class (IIC)
Ceramic tile over Insulayment (latex modified thin set and grout), over wood floor structure with 1 1/2” of Gypcrete. IIC=52.
Sound Transmission Class (STC)
Ceramic tile over Insulayment (latex modified thin set and grout), over wood floor structure with 1 1/2” of Gypcrete. STC=53.
Physical Properties
Weight and Density +/- 10% tolerance. Thickness +/- 5% tolerance.
Performance Level
.
Rated as "Extra Heavy" for "extra heavy and high impact use in food plants, dairies, breweries, and kitchens" when installed using porcelain tile & epoxy grout. (ASTM C627 — Robinson Floor Test)
Rated as "Light Commercial" for "office space, reception areas, kitchens, and bathrooms" when installed using residential tile and latex modified thin set and grout. (ASTM C627 — Robinson Floor Test)
